Medium (25 – 60 lbs) Learn MoreMemphis Belle finally has her second chance at a real life. This little English Bulldog was a puppy mill girl, who was thrown in the mountains of Taiwan after her breeders were done using her. She arrived at Rocket Dog extremely malnourished, devoid of a life of love, human affection, or structure.
She is estimated to be approximately 6-8 years of age and has a very sweet/goofy temperament. Belle is great with other dogs, enjoys being outside, and would love to have a human companion who is home with her during the day to provide the necessary affection and guidance that she needs. She has blossomed tremendously during her time in foster care; Belle has come out of her shell and is learning how to finally enjoy her new life of sleeping, eating, playing, and being a normal lazy bulldog.
Belle would do best in a home with someone who is going to be very patient and understanding of her background, as well as experienced with the bulldog breed. She loves toys, so perhaps a home without young children since she can have some attitude about her playtime (though she is great with kids). Belle is not cat tested, but does well with her foster mom’s 80 lb Olde English Bulldogge at home. Because she was in a crate her whole life, she would love to have a backyard in her new house to roam around and sunbathe in during the day. She is lovely little lady who has been through a lot in life and deserves to finally have a loving forever home.
